Description of Training Courses **All classes are 1 hour long, 1 time per week (unless otherwise stated)**
AKC Star Puppy Class: 8-12 weeks of age 6 week Course: Prepare you and your pup for the Star Puppy Test. The first class is without pets, just the owners so we can go over what is expected of you and your pup. The next five classes concentrate on preparing for the Star Puppy Real Deal.
AKC Star Puppy Real Deal Single Session: We test you and your dog on the AKC Star Puppy in accordance with the standards set the by the American Kennel Club.
Puppy: 8-12 weeks of age 5 Week Course: Classes will be assembled according to size of breed and will incorporate basic puppy socialization with question and answer time during the class. We will discuss and offer advice for potty training, conditioning your dog to a clicker, walking on a leash and how to address a variety of unwanted behaviors. By working together we can start your pup off in the right way.
Basic Obedience: Must be at least 12 weeks 5 Week Course: This class is for young pups or dogs that are ready to learn their basic commands. We will teach walking on a loose leash, sit, down, place command and the beginning of a recall command (coming back when called). For our social participants we will have 15 minutes of socialization to help make training fun!
Advance Obedience: Must have Basic Obedience 6 Week Course: This class is for the dogs that have mastered basic obedience and are now ready to move on to the next step of those commands. We will take the loose leash and turn it into a heel command with a courtesy sit. The sit command will become strong, enabling your dog to stay in that sit until released. The same applies to the down and place commands. We work hard on the recall with an ultimate goal of having your dog come straight back and sitting for you. Again, playtime will help stretch their legs and provide a great way to end the session!
Intro to Canine Good Citizen (CGC) 6 Week Course: If your dog has mastered the advance obedience class you may want to consider the Intro to Canine Good Citizen. In this class we will explain the test and explore all ten situations that you and your dog will be tested upon. Each week we will work on two of those situations. By the end of this class you will know exactly what will be expected of you to pass the Canine Good Citizen test. This class will be done with the training tool of your choice.
CGC: Final Prep 4 Week Course: This class follows the Intro to CGC. You will not be permitted to use any training tool that is not allowed in the actual test. We work hard in each class to prepare you to pass the final CGC test. Again, we will take two situations each night and work hard on them so you will feel comfortable, confident and ready for the real deal!
CGC: The Real Deal Single Session: We test you and your dog on Canine Good Citizenship in accordance with standards set by the American Kennel Club.
